## Tuning

Routewisp resolves deep links in two passes: scheme match, then path-pattern scoring. Most misroutes trace back to overly aggressive fallback timeouts, not pattern bugs. Bump timeouts before touching scoring weights. Changes require a cold app start to take effect; the Fenlark cache does not invalidate on config reload. Defaults below were validated against the Orvand test corpus. Current constants are listed here.

constants for tafog-kahag:
RATE_LIMITS = {
    "sorir": 697,
    "oliox": 683,
    "holax": 176,
    "casox": 60,
    "pelius": 382,
}

For the weekly sync: the PrintHerald spooler microservice stopped accepting jobs Tuesday because its credential to the Quenchline render service expired. Jobs queued for roughly four hours before Marisol's team noticed. A fresh credential has been issued and rotation is now tracked in the service calendar. The replacement key for the Quenchline endpoint is below.

app token of bahaf-tajeg = zpat23_SjjsllwiLmXbtS65veZaV47

## Runbook: Gaugepile Sidecar — Release Checklist

Heads up: the sidecar ships with every app pod, so a bad config fans out fast. Before cutting a release, confirm the flush interval hasn't drifted from what the Tallyhouse aggregator expects, or you'll see sawtooth gaps in dashboards. Rollbacks are cheap — just repin the image tag. Canary one node pool first, watch for ten minutes, then proceed. The values to verify against are these.

config for bagep-yafof:
quenath:
  pin: 8584
  metrics_host: metrics.quenath.tolvaqsys.internal
  tenant: pelath
  seal: seal_ed102645